PITTSBURGH, Sept. 1, 2020 /PRNewswire/ -- "It's uncomfortable trying to watch a 3D movie while holding the 3D glasses over your prescription glasses," said an inventor, from Pittsfield, Mass. "I thought there could be a better way, so I invented the VIZION X."
The invention enables prescription lens wearers to easily enjoy 3D cinema movies. In doing so, it eliminates the need to wear 3D glasses over prescription glasses. As a result, it helps to prevent optical discrepancies, double reflections and slight optical distortions and it could make the movie experience more enjoyable. The invention features a user-friendly design that is convenient and easy to use so it is ideal for individuals who wear prescription glasses. Additionally, it is producible in design variations.
The inventor described the invention design. "My design offers an alternative to struggling with traditional 3D glasses."
